# How to plot attribute value change by time based on the hour

I have a set of data which records a count "Ctrlr_Cycle_Cnt" every 10-20 minutes. The count is always incremental. I want to get the average change rate [(cnt2-cnt1) / (timestamp2 - timestamp1)] on the hour. Essentially x-axis will be hours of a day (1-24, 24 bins) and y-axis is the average change rate for every hour. Assuming I take all data into account.

Attached is the workbook

Maybe I did not make it clear enough. What I meant is to plot the average rate by hour. In other words it is the difference of ctrlr_cycle_cnt between two timestamps that I care about, not the absolute value at each data point.

For example:

Day 1: 10:10 - 100; 10:30 - 200; 10:50 - 350. [rate of 10-11am of day 1] = ((200-100)/20 + (380-200)/20)/2 = 7

Day 2: 10:05 - 400; 10:25 - 560; 10:55 - 860. [rate of 10-11am of day 2] = ((560-400)/20  + (860-560)/30)/2 = 9

so the average rate for hour 10am is (7+9)/2 = 8

I want to plot this for all 24 hours for all the data in the past (around 2 months worth of data).